About Lawnella WP Theme
Lawnella is a WordPress theme built by SteelThemes for lawn care, landscaping, and garden service businesses. It comes with a clean layout focused on local service conversions: prominent phone numbers, service area sections, before-and-after image galleries, and quote request forms built in.
The theme works with Elementor, making it accessible for business owners who want to update content without touching code. It includes pre-built page templates for services, pricing, testimonials, and a blog. The design is mobile-first, which matters for local trades where most visitors arrive from a phone after a quick Google search.
SteelThemes designed Lawnella specifically for outdoor service companies, so the layout decisions reflect real business needs rather than a generic multipurpose template stretched to fit.

Pros
- Purpose-built for lawn and landscaping businesses, not a generic theme adapted for the niche
- Elementor-compatible, so non-technical owners can update content and seasonal promotions without a developer
- Includes pre-built templates for services, pricing tables, testimonials, and quote request forms
- Mobile-first layout with prominent click-to-call buttons suited to local search traffic
- Before-and-after image gallery section built in, useful for showcasing completed lawn transformations
Cons
- Limited out-of-box booking or scheduling functionality; a plugin or custom integration is usually needed
- Design feels familiar to other SteelThemes products, so differentiation requires custom work
- Demo import can overwrite settings if not handled carefully, creating extra cleanup work
- Fewer third-party tutorials and community resources compared to major multipurpose themes like Astra or Divi
- WooCommerce support for selling service packages requires additional configuration not covered in documentation

Lawnella common issues
Lawnella contact form not sending emails
This is almost always an email deliverability problem, not a form issue. WordPress uses wp_mail() by default, which many hosts block or flag as spam. Install an SMTP plugin like WP Mail SMTP and connect it to a transactional email provider such as Mailgun, SendGrid, or your Google Workspace account. Test the form after configuring SMTP. Lawnella Elementor layout broken after update
Elementor layout breaks after updates are usually caused by a version mismatch between Elementor, Elementor Pro, and the theme. Check that all three are updated to compatible versions. If the layout is broken after a specific update, use a staging site to roll back the plugin version and identify the conflict. Regenerating the CSS cache inside Elementor’s settings often resolves visual glitches without a full rollback. Lawnella mobile menu not working
A broken mobile menu in Lawnella usually points to a JavaScript conflict with another plugin. Open your browser’s developer console on the mobile view and look for JS errors. Common culprits are optimization plugins that minify or defer scripts incorrectly. In your caching or performance plugin, exclude the theme’s navigation scripts from deferral. If you recently added a cookie consent or chat plugin, temporarily disable it to confirm whether that is the source. If the problem persists after an update, the theme’s menu toggle script may need a targeted fix.
Lawnella demo import not loading correctly
Demo import failures in Lawnella are often caused by PHP memory limits or upload size restrictions on your hosting account. Before importing, set max_execution_time to 300, memory_limit to 256M, and upload_max_filesize to at least 64M in your php.ini or via your host’s control panel. Import in stages if a one-click import is failing: import content first, then widgets, then customizer settings. Lawnella does not include a native booking system. The most common integrations are Bookly, Simply Schedule Appointments, or Calendly embedded via a widget. Each has different complexity levels. Bookly offers the most control over service types and staff scheduling but requires more setup. A developer can integrate any of these with Lawnella’s quote form so submissions flow into your booking calendar automatically.
